"Portret van Jean-Antoine de Mesmes, comte d'Avaux" is an engraving by Dutch artist Reinier Vinkeles, created between 1751 and 1816. This detailed portrait, currently housed in the Rijksmuseum, features Jean-Antoine de Mesmes, Comte d'Avaux, in a round frame. The engraving captures the sitter’s likeness with meticulous detail, showcasing Vinkeles' mastery of the art form. The image is framed with a decorative border and is a striking example of the portrait engraving style popular during the 18th century.
